Handover for FeedWarden, our podcast feed validator, from Ilsa to the support rotation. Key points: validation runs in two passes — schema checks first, then episode-level audits. Most customer complaints trace to enclosure size mismatches, which we flag as warnings, not errors; please explain this distinction carefully when responding. The retry queue for slow feeds clears hourly. Known false positives are catalogued with reproduction steps. The full triage playbook is maintained on the internal page listed below.

wiki page, bawef-hafop: https://jira.nelvroworks.corp/job/pages/projects/7c5c0f440dbd

TICKET PX-CACHE: Memory leak in image cache

Summary: PicoVault thumbnail cache grows unbounded under repeated gallery scrolls. Evicted entries keep decoded bitmaps alive via a stale listener reference. Fix removes the listener on eviction and caps decoded buffers at 256 MB.

Impact: app kills on low-memory devices; roughly 40 support reports this month.

Status: patch tested on staging, heap stable over 6-hour soak. Support should hold replies until release ships. Release cannot go out until sign-off from the approver listed below.

named custodian: Brivan Eliath Quenox Frador

For the sync: PixelProof snapshot runs are getting chunky — the Marigold design system alone generates ~18k image diffs per PR, and storage on the Fenwick cluster is at 70%. We want to prune baselines older than 30 days and cap parallel render workers. Proposed knobs, pending sign-off from infra, are listed below.

tuning table, yajog-yahof:
BUDGETS = {
    "lamvan": 303,
    "wenox": 460,
    "fenvan": 525,
}

**Ticket KV-207: Bloom filter false-negative after resize**

Heads up, future maintainers: the bloom filter fronting Pebblevault can return false negatives (yes, really) right after an online resize, because the old bit array is swapped out before the rebuild finishes backfilling. Net effect: reads skip the store and report missing keys that absolutely exist. Short-term mitigation is to disable the filter during resize windows. If you're bisecting this, the regression first appears in the build noted below.

build token for kagaf-hahof: htk14_9d3d4d26d7d8de